When did World War I take place?
1914–1918
What event triggered WWI?
The assassination of Archduke Franz Ferdinand of Austria-Hungary in Sarajevo on June 28, 1914
What were the two main alliance systems in WWI?
The Allied Powers (France, Britain, Russia, later the US) and the Central Powers (Germany, Austria-Hungary, Ottoman Empire, Bulgaria)
What was trench warfare?
A type of combat where opposing sides fought from fortified trenches, leading to a devastating stalemate on the Western Front
What was the Schlieffen Plan?
Germany's military strategy to avoid a two-front war by quickly defeating France through Belgium before turning to fight Russia
What was the Battle of the Somme?
A 1916 battle on the Western Front; one of the deadliest in history with over 1 million casualties
What was the Battle of Verdun?
A grueling 10-month battle in 1916 between German and French forces, symbolizing the horrors of WWI attrition warfare
Why did the United States enter WWI?
Unrestricted German submarine warfare sinking American ships and the Zimmermann Telegram proposing a German-Mexican alliance against the US
What was the Zimmermann Telegram?
A 1917 secret German diplomatic communication proposing a military alliance with Mexico against the United States
What was the Treaty of Versailles?
The 1919 peace treaty ending WWI that imposed heavy reparations and territorial losses on Germany, contributing to WWII's causes
